Definition
/ˈklæɹɪfaɪ/
verb
- (of liquids, such as wine or syrup) To make clear or bright by freeing from feculent matter
- To make clear or easily understood; to explain in order to remove doubt or obscurity
- To grow or become clear or transparent; to become free from feculent impurities, as wine or other liquid under clarification.“Leave the wine for 24 hours and it will clarify.”
- To grow clear or bright; to clear up.
- To glorify.
